UPLINK POWER CONTROL SIGNALING WITH CARRIER AGGREGATION |
摘要 |
Technology for providing uplink power control signaling for semi-persistent scheduling with carrier aggregation is disclosed. One method comprises receiving a transmitter power control (TPC) carrier aggregation (CA) physical downlink control channel (PDCCH) configuration information element (IE) identifying a location of information to adjust an uplink power control of a selected component carrier of the UE using semi-persistent scheduling. The TPC-CA-PDCCH configuration IE includes a carrier index value for the selected component carrier of the UE to allow a power level of the selected component carrier to be individually adjusted. A power level of a physical uplink shared channel and/or a physical uplink control channel can be adjusted for the selected component carrier. |

主权项 |
1. A user equipment (UE) configured to provide uplink power control signaling for semi-persistent scheduling with carrier aggregation, comprising:
a transmitter power control (TPC) module configured to receive a TPC physical downlink control channel (PDCCH) configuration information element (IE) identifying a TPC index value and a location of information to adjust an uplink power control of a selected component carrier associated with the UE, wherein the UE is configured to provide semi-persistent scheduling; a TPC assignment module configured to assign a TPC index value to at least one component carrier based on the TPC index value assigned to the selected component carrier; and a power adjustment module configured to adjust a power level of at least one of a physical uplink shared channel (PUSCH) and a physical uplink control channel (PUCCH) for the selected component carrier and the at least one component carrier. |
